Handover note — Crumbwheel order cutoffs.

Welcome aboard. The bakery cutoff rule in Crumbwheel closes same-day orders at 14:00 local to each storefront, not UTC — this has bitten us twice. Holiday overrides live in the calendar service and take precedence silently, so always check there first when a cutoff looks wrong. To unlock the calendar service's admin console after a restart, enter the recovery passphrase below.

vault phrase of bagap-bahaf = silion-pelox-sorox-casdor-quenwyn-fraax-eliox-praael-kelion-quenvan-kasox-rusael-norius-belvan

## Seed Sample Transport — Plot K-4

Verdane Agronomics ships sealed seed envelopes to the Halloway trial plot each Monday. Samples travel in the grey rigid case, desiccant pouch included. Do not split batches; plot integrity depends on full sets. Courier signs the chain-of-custody sheet at both ends. Temperature logs stay with the case, not the driver. Return empty cases Friday via the same route. The hand-over instruction below is confidential and must be read to the courier verbatim before departure.

handover note for yagef-bagep: the drudor pelius courier leaves the kasdor zorvan norir ledger at gate 8016 under passcode 755406

## Runbook: TimeWeave Solver Restarts

If the TimeWeave solver wedges mid-run (usually during the Northvale District import), just bounce the `tw-solver` pod — partial schedules are checkpointed, so nothing's lost. Before re-queuing, warm the constraint cache via the internal SlotGrid API so the first pass doesn't crawl. The call needs auth; use the key below.

API key for tagug-tajef: vxb4-R1fo

## Onboarding — Markdown Pipeline (Inkmere)

Inkmere docs render through a three-stage pipeline: parse, sanitize, emit. Releases rebuild all templates; never hot-patch emitted HTML. Broken renders usually mean a sanitizer rule change — check the rules diff first. The render cluster only accepts builds from the release channel, and every build artifact must be signed before upload. Sign artifacts with the deploy key below.

release key, hafop-tajef: bky13_s2vaFVNJTHfBL